Nashcon will be held Jun 2 – 4, 2017, Franklin Marriott Cool Springs, just south of Nashville.
nashcon.org

picture

My friends, Ben and David Raybin present another mega-game: The Battle of Mars-La-Tour fought on 16 August 1870, during the Franco-Prussian War. Two Prussian corps encountered the entire French Army of the Rhine in a meeting engagement and, after one more battle, successfully forced the Army of the Rhine to retreat into the fortress of Metz. The Battle of Mars-La-Tour is also notable for one of the very last successful cavalry charges of modern warfare. Of the 800 horsemen who had started out, only 420 returned. Among the wounded was Lieutenant Herbert von Bismarck, son of the Prussian chancellor Otto von Bismarck.
The board is 6 by 12 feet using 28mm figures ( and for Nashcon, a few acres of Cigar Box battle maps ) and the new rules: Bloody Big Battles which is sort of like Fire and Fury but on an operational scale. Its time Nashcon experienced this great new rules set: 10 players will get the opportunity.
We tested this rules set based on great reviews.
